    MYOB have finally responded to the outcry, and they say they are working on fixing it.

     

    They also said this:

    "We’re investigating an issue with the Bankfeed allocation service; in the meantime, you can manually match transactions as a workaround."

     

    What it means for many of us is that you will need to manually CREATE a Spend Money or Receive Money transaction in the Banking section, selecting the appropriate account/category, and ensure it exactly matches the bank feed transaction amount and date, then you can go back to bank feeds and match the transaction to the one you manually created. This worked for me last night, but I was very glad I only had two of them to do!
